The Fact About what is md5 technology That No One Is Suggesting
The Fact About what is md5 technology That No One Is Suggesting
Blog Article
For these so-named collision assaults to operate, an attacker should be ready to control two individual inputs while in the hope of finally acquiring two individual mixtures which have a matching hash.
Cryptographic practices evolve as new attack practices and vulnerabilities emerge. For that reason, it is vital to update stability measures often and abide by the most recent suggestions from dependable cryptographic specialists.
Since we've got a tackle on how the MD5 algorithm performs, let's discuss the place it matches into the planet of cryptography. It's kind of similar to a Swiss Army knife, which has a large number of utilizes in various situations. So, where by do we regularly spot MD5 undertaking its issue?
Considered one of the first takes advantage of of MD5 hashes during the cybersecurity and antivirus realms is in detecting any variants in just data files. an antivirus application can utilize the MD5 hash of the cleanse file and Review it Along with the hash of the exact same file in a later on time.
In lieu of confirming that two sets of data are equivalent by comparing the Uncooked data, MD5 does this by making a checksum on both of those sets then evaluating the checksums to verify that they are the same.
The essential idea driving MD5 will be to take a concept or facts file of any duration and compute a digest, or a unique mounted-sized output that signifies the content of the original file.
Each of the attacker must deliver two colliding information is a template file which has a 128-byte block of information, aligned on a sixty four-byte boundary, that may be improved freely with the collision-discovering algorithm. An illustration MD5 collision, With all the two messages differing click here in six bits, is: d131dd02c5e6eec4 693d9a0698aff95c 2fcab58712467eab 4004583eb8fb7f89
Nevertheless, it's important to notice that these solutions can only make MD5 safer, although not fully Protected. Systems have progressed, and so hold the tactics to crack them.
Cyclic redundancy Look at (CRC) codes: CRC codes are certainly not hash features, but They're comparable to MD5 in they use algorithms to check for faults and corrupted knowledge. CRC codes are quicker at authenticating than MD5, but They are really considerably less secure.
Released as RFC 1321 all around 30 many years ago, the MD5 information-digest algorithm remains to be widely used now. Utilizing the MD5 algorithm, a 128-little bit additional compact output could be produced from the concept input of variable duration. This can be a type of cryptographic hash which is designed to generate electronic signatures, compressing significant information into more compact ones in a safe fashion then encrypting them with A personal ( or key) key to generally be matched using a public essential. MD5 can be used to detect file corruption or inadvertent improvements inside of large collections of documents as a command-line implementation working with typical Computer system languages like Java, Perl, or C.
On the globe of Pc science and cryptography, hashing algorithms Perform a vital position in a variety of apps. They offer a means to securely retail store and validate details, allowing for us to examine the integrity and authenticity of data.
Blake2. Blake2 can be a substantial-velocity cryptographic hash functionality which offers security comparable to SHA-3 but is faster and much more productive concerning performance. It's appropriate for the two cryptographic and non-cryptographic programs.
MD5 performs by breaking apart the input knowledge into blocks, and then iterating above Just about every block to apply a number of mathematical operations to create an output that is exclusive for that block. These outputs are then combined and more processed to generate the final digest.
The MD5 hash purpose’s stability is thought to be severely compromised. Collisions are available in just seconds, and they can be utilized for malicious uses. The truth is, in 2012, the Flame spy ware that infiltrated thousands of computer systems and products in Iran was viewed as one of the most troublesome security issues of the yr.